decrease_time = setInterval(decrease_opacity_val,10); function decrease_opacity_val(){ showID.style.opacity = showID.style.opacity - 0.01; if(showID.style.opacity == 0) { clearInterval(decrease_time); showID.style.display = "none"; showID.style.opacity = ""; leftID.style.display = "block"; leftID.style.opacity = 0; increase_time = setInterval(increase_opacity_val,10); } } function increase_opacity_val(){ //加加需要使用parseFloat转换 leftID.style.opacity = parseFloat(leftID.style.opacity) + 0.01; if(leftID.style.opacity == 1) { clearInterval(increase_time); leftID.style.opacity = ""; } }
相关推荐
前端开发中,我们会会经常使用定时器setinterval setTimeout等,但当我们离开页面时,定时器会被阻塞,导致我们再回到页面的时候定时任务会混乱运行,为些我的解决方案写了个简单demo,希望对你有所帮助
博文链接:https://fangyong2006.iteye.com/blog/157398
使用setInterval()模拟进度条 使用setInterval()模拟进度条
关于JS定时器(setTimeout setInterval)定时不准问题1
window.clearInterval与window.setInterval的用法.
Javascript定时器(二)——setTimeout与setInterval 在 http://www.cnblogs.com/strick/p/3983904.html 有说明
博文链接:https://weiweichen1985.iteye.com/blog/193628
使用SetInterval和设定延时函数setTimeout 很类似。setTimeout 运用在延迟一段时间,再进行某项操作。
html5利用setInterval实现新年元旦倒计时
setInterval setTimeout.html
setinterval倒计 HTML倒计时
JavaScript提供定时执行代码的功能,叫做定时器(timer),主要由setTimeout()和setInterval()这两个函数来完成。而这篇文中主要给大家介绍的是关于JS中setTimeout和setInterval最大延时值的相关问题,需要的朋友们...
JS中的setTimeout和setInterval的区别JS中的setTimeout和setInterval的区别JS中的setTimeout和setInterval的区别
06-setInterval.html
NULL 博文链接:https://wwwzhouhui.iteye.com/blog/585388
NULL 博文链接:https://rainbow702.iteye.com/blog/1668935
NULL 博文链接:https://jiajunli.iteye.com/blog/2155518
javascript中的setInterval的函数主要是在制作动画或其他间隔性渲染(操作)效果时,对操作方法按照一定时间间隔进行调用的函数。 setInterval的表达式格式主要有: setInterval(fnname,time,par1,par2,……..parn);...
Java Script中setinterval怎么用?怎么才能让setinterval停下来?.pdf